First of all I just want to say I was really impressed with the Cookeville coaching staff. They were undersized, slower, yet they didn't allow a big play all night on defense against Riverdale. To me this game right here shows how good Riverdale really is. Cookeville ran at my count around 10 trick plays and still only scored 7 points, held Riverdale in check most of the night on defense and still gave up 28 points. I do want to comment on the one Cookeville touchdown. First I must say Cookeville had three very impressive drives on the night, alot of trick plays involved, but nonetheless moved the ball very well on Riverdale. On the other hand, i was on the corner of the field where Cookeville scored their touchdown and it should have never happened. Cookeville had a 4th down and 10 at the Riverdale 11 I believe. On the play, Cookeville's QB overthrew his reciever by a good 10 yards, and Riverdale was called for holding on the play. The problems was the reciever was pushed, not held, and it happened two yards from the line of scrimmage which is legal, add to that the ball being overthrown 10 yards. I know where the ball ends up on a holding call does not matter, but pushing within 5 yards is legal. The reason I mentioned this is the referees ended the Riverdale defense scoring streak, not Cookeville. But I still commend Cookeville on their effort, and their coaching was awsome tonight. Your crowd too almost seemed louder on big plays than the Riverdale side on big plays. Congradualtions Cookeville on a great season, with that coach you guys will be back here shortly. Go Warriors!
